Hallöchen,
kann mir jemand sagen wie man einen Zeilenumbruch innerhalb eines Daten/Tabellenfeldes in Arcview macht? Ich möchte die Daten nicht wie einen langen Rattenschwanz hintereinander schreiben...
Marion - Danke
kann mir jemand sagen wie man einen Zeilenumbruch innerhalb eines Daten/Tabellenfeldes in Arcview macht? Ich möchte die Daten nicht wie einen langen Rattenschwanz hintereinander schreiben...
Marion - Danke
- Anmelden oder Registieren, um Kommentare verfassen zu können
Gespeichert von Tobias am Mi., 03.11.2004 - 11:52
Permalinkkann es sein das du dieses meinst...
http://www.juergenevert.de/arcview/tipps/tippframe.html
unter "Beschriftung mit mehreren Feldern"
Zitat: Trennen Sie dabei die Inhalte der Felder mit dem Wagenrücklaufzeichen (10.aschar), um die Angaben untereinander angeordnet auszugeben (Juergen Evert)
Allerdings weiß ich nicht ob man dann mehrere Zeilen in der Tabelle sehen kann.
Gruß Tobi
Gespeichert von Gast am Mi., 03.11.2004 - 12:12
PermalinkDas ist leider nicht das was ich suche...es geht mir nicht um die Beschriftung mit Daten aus mehreren Feldern. Ich möchte einfach nur in einer Arcview-Datentabelle in einem beliebigen Feld einen Zeilenumbruch machen...in diesem Feld habe ich einer Fläche Kartierungsergebnisse mehrerer JAhre zugeordnet--> diese stehen nun alle hintereinander weg...und ich möchte nun nach den jeweiligen Ergebnissen für jedes Jahr einen Zeilenumbruch machen (damit die Spalte nicht allzu lang wird). Ich hoffe ich konnte das jetzt verständlicher rüberbringen...
Marion
Gespeichert von Gast am Mi., 03.11.2004 - 12:47
PermalinkGespeichert von Gast am Mi., 03.11.2004 - 12:49
Permalinkdas wird so nicht funktionieren. AV ist halt "nur" eine Datenbank.
Aber wäre es nicht sinnvoll, für jedes Jahr eine Spalte anzulegen?
Gruß
Sven
Gespeichert von Gast am Mi., 03.11.2004 - 12:53
PermalinkTrotzdem danke - Marion
Gespeichert von uwelangehh am Mi., 03.11.2004 - 13:26
Permalinkes ginge wie folgt:
1. Anstelle des Zeilenumbruches schreibst du ein Sonderzeichen, im folgenden Beispiel #
2. im Calculator aktivierst du den Advanced Modus (Haekchen setzen)
3. Im obeeren Feld gibst du folgendes ein:
' Beliebigen Text ersetzen
Dim strAlterText As String
Dim strNeuerText As String
strAlterText = [Objektart]
' Text ersetzen
strNeuerText = Replace(strAlterText, "#", Chr(13) & Chr(10))
4. unten muesste dann stehen:
strNeuerText
Viel Erfolg und Gruss
Uwe
Gespeichert von uwelangehh am Mi., 03.11.2004 - 13:34
Permalinkich fuerchte, wir sprechen nicht dieselbe Sprache. Sorry, ich war in Gedanken im ArcView 8-Forum! Falls du den beschriebenen Loesungsweg aber gehen moechtest, hier ist er noch mal uebersetzt in Avenueisch. Im Calculator von ArcView 3 musst du folgende Formel eingeben:
[MeinFeld].Substitute("#", nl)
Das waere alles und macht mir gleich wieder klar, warum ich Avenue nachtrauere.
Sniff!
Uwe
Gespeichert von Gast am Mi., 03.11.2004 - 14:24
PermalinkGespeichert von Gast am Mi., 03.11.2004 - 18:13
PermalinkIn ArcGis geht's doch auch ohne den Advanced Aufwand:
Replace([Objektart],"#",vbcr)
Gespeichert von uwelangehh am Mi., 03.11.2004 - 18:41
PermalinkUwe